  • Patent number: 8867025
    Abstract: An aerial, landing, takeoff, aircraft collision avoidance system (10) that automatically operates an audible and visual display warning system within an aircraft by sensing when there is an intruder aircraft approaching on the same runway, intersecting runway, or same airway during climb, descent, and midair flight by employing a five-way interactive communication system using laser and radio wave technology and, thereby, providing added safety and protection for users of the system and oncoming aircrafts while being designed to automatically open a simultaneous three-way line of communication between pilots and air traffic controllers during crisis; identify and alert aircrafts what runways are presently in use during landings, taxiing, and takeoffs; and identify what runways are in use to taxiing aircrafts that may inadvertently cross a runway without clearance from air traffic control.

  • Patent number: 6963275
    Abstract: A flashing warning light apparatus (10) for warning motorists in oncoming traffic that an object such as a car is stopped near the highway ahead. The apparatus (10) includes a housing (24) with an array of lights (12) on the front and possibly also the rear faces. Sensors (14) front and back sense oncoming traffic. A switch (36) allows the user to cause the arrays of lights (12) to flash continuously or only when oncoming traffic is sensed. The device may be powered by the car battery through a cigarette lighter adapter (34), dry cell batteries (28) or a solar cell (44).

  • Patent number: 5914651
    Abstract: A new Vehicle Safety Emergency Flasher System for automatically operating a flashing light system within a vehicle by sensing when there is another approaching vehicle thereby protecting oncoming drivers while conserving a charge within a battery of the vehicle. The inventive device includes a plurality of photo-transistors, a control panel having a central processing unit electrically coupled to the photo-transistors, a multi-positioned hazard switch electrically coupled to the control panel, a receiver, and a transmitter. The photo-transistors detect motion from moving vehicles or light from the headlights of a vehicle thereby triggering the flashing of a plurality of conventional hazard lights electrically coupled to the control panel. After the vehicle has passed, the conventional hazard lights are deactivated thereby conserving a charge within a battery of the vehicle.
